I've found some old images of RLA and RPF types which are opened by xnview 1.82 without any problem, but new RC1 can not open all of them. Only 32 bit images are opening, not 64-floating point.
I've send these images to you. Not tested with betas.
One remark - xnview 1.82 has standard plugins installed separetly. May be the problem is there.
